I consider myself a beginner guitar player with 1 month of fidgeting with my Yamaha. I came to George's to get more guitar picks. I unexpectedly had an excellent experience trying out different guitars and buying one in the end. I actually didn't have the intention of getting a guitar because I knew so little about them as a beginner but I occasionally browsed online prior to my visit. Brendan was very knowledgable about the different guitars and which ones would work best for me based on my budget and preferences. I was looking for a guitar that had a smaller body to use so that I wouldn't feel uncomfortable because I am quite small. But I still wanted it to be full length so I could learn how to play with the standard amount of frets. Brendan showed me different guitars and let me jam out by myself in the guitar room which was very nice. Though they have a lot of expertise, they were very open and made me feel comfortable asking many different questions as a beginner. There is no judgment here at this store and no pressure. Just pure love for music and a desire to help share the knowledge! Btw: the guitar I ended up getting was the Taylor Academy 12 for $550. I was first shown an Ibanez for $300 because my budget was $500 and under. Brendan then told me there was a Taylor guitar for $550 that also matched by preferences and asked me permission to show it to me first. I thought that was so considerate of them. I am glad I took a look at it because it sounds great (I compared it to my Yamaha guitar and the Ibanez). It will last me my entire guitar career (according to my friend Joey who is obsessed with guitars and I would consider an expert. He loves my guitar and spent a good amount of time gushing over it and playing it even though he has much more expensive Taylors). It's been about a week since I got it and I am really happy with how it sounds when I play. I've also lengthened my practice time since I got it because of how much I love it. I might decide to buy another guitar in the future but it feels good knowing that the one I got already has such great quality. Thanks to the team at George's Music for their excellent service and expertise!

It was an absolutely wonderful experience shopping for a guitar at George’s Music North Wales. I’m a beginner guitar player and I was looking to buy my first “serious” acoustic guitar. Dwight and Austin were so kind and patient showing me around the acoustic room and being cognizant of my wants of a guitar with a shorter scale length and size while being in my budget. I had a blast playing the Taylor GS Mini and the Martin 000-Jr-10E cutout version! I asked Dwight that I wanted to try the Martin dreadnought junior 10E as well before taking a final decision and Dwight went above and beyond to order the DJr-10E for me from the Spring City store. I went in the next day, played it both plugged and unplugged, fell in love with the sound and bought the latter! Thanks a ton, folks, and I will be coming back here for all my musical needs. P.S.: Brownie points for the discussions regarding Opeth and Pat Metheny!

Yea they sell a lot of good material and they are really nice enough to help refer you to different businesses when they dont have what you may want or need. The only thing stopping me from giving them 5 stars is that they are among the many guitar stores ive been to that sell too many floating tremolo/floyd rose replica guitars with that system. This is not bad enough to stop me from going here and if you are new they will obviously let you know that you are buying a guitar with this system on it so thats not a bad thing by itself. What they wont tell you however is to consider a guitar repair guy when buying one of these guitars because changing strings and fixing spring tension after downtuning (even though floyd roses are specifically not as good or designed for down or drop tuning I understand but certain people may only be able to afford one guitar so thats why they may do it anyways) will need the attention of some kind of person who understands these kinds of repairs even though its not even a really super broken repair like some other things that could happen to a guitar. They are allowed so sell whatever guitars they want and I am not saying this to make them stop selling floyd rose guitars but the feedback I would recommend giving you guys reading this is to just communicate to customers who buy these guitars and to recommend them or refer them to a guitar repair shop if they are interesting in knowing after asking them about it the first time or if they already know and arent interested. And if they still arent sold on handing their guitar to a repair guy for these kinds of problems you can also let them know that most simpler floyd rose repairs are almost always done within the budget of 100$ or less and I say that from my experience and the repair guys I went to but that should be accurate enough that most guitar repair folks should charge around the same price. But yea only ask them once if they would like to know a repair shop when they buy these guitars just because a polite simple yes or no question could go an even longer way in having them wanting to come back to your store because you have really good customer service and you always look out on what you already can serve at your store or what you can refer customers to outside your store. I hope I have helped you guys with my review you guys already do a lot of good things whenever I come in this is just my small suggestion of how I think you could do even better among all of the other things I already like about you guys....
